## Alert: StatRelay Sidecar Flush Lag

This alert fires when the StatRelay metrics-aggregation sidecar falls more than 120 seconds behind on flushing buffered samples to the Coalmine backend. Plugin-emitted counters are buffered in-process, so sustained lag usually means a plugin is emitting unbounded label cardinality or blocking the flush thread. Check your plugin's metric registration against the published cardinality limits before escalating. If the lag persists after your plugin is ruled out, contact the telemetry team.

escalation mailbox, bagug-fahof: novdor.wendor.jormir@norvalabs.example

## Tuning the autocomplete index

Heads up for reviewers: Quillseek's autocomplete index got sluggish after we widened the prefix window, and the fix was mostly constant-twiddling, not new code paths. Nothing here touches auth or input validation — the trie is built from already-sanitized tokens. Still, eyeball the batch sizes, since oversized rebuilds could be abused for resource exhaustion. The values we settled on after load testing are below.

limits module of tafop-fawef:
PRIORITIES = {
    "eliiel": 453,
    "sormir": 605,
}

Ticket: Config drift — Pellgrove reconnect loop

Clients on the gamma pool reconnect every ~30s. Root cause: gamma's websocket heartbeat settings drifted from the baseline after a manual hotfix in March and were never reverted. Fix is to restore baseline and redeploy. Since you're new: don't hand-edit pool configs. The expected baseline values are pasted below for reference.

deployment values, bahop-yadug:
[caswyn]
port = 8443
region = east-4
host = caswyn.lumicworks.internal
timeout_ms = 5000
retries = 8

# Hexadiff env file — staging
#
# Hexadiff is our diff viewer for large files; it streams chunks from the
# Bramblewood object cache instead of loading whole blobs in memory.
# Release managers: CHUNK_SIZE_MB and MAX_STREAM_WORKERS below are tuned
# for the staging hosts — do not copy production values here, they will
# exhaust memory on the smaller nodes. The viewer also signs cache reads,
# and the signing secret must appear on the very next line.

vault entry, bagaf-fahog: ARCHIVE_KEY3=71e